Your coworker is facing a personal crisis. How can you demonstrate empathy and support?
When a coworker is grappling with a personal crisis, it's a situation that calls for sensitivity, understanding, and support. Emotional Intelligence (EI) is the ability to perceive, evaluate, and respond to your own emotions and the emotions of others. Demonstrating high EI can make a significant difference in providing comfort and aid to a colleague in need. It involves active listening, empathy, and appropriate action to show that you genuinely care about their well-being. Remember, your role isn't to solve their problems but to be a source of support as they navigate through their tough times.
